Understanding 4K Technology

Key Standards

Digital Cinema Initiatives (DCI) plays a crucial role in establishing 2K and 4K container formats for digital cinema projection, ensuring high-quality viewing experiences. SMPTE ST 2036-1 standardizes Ultra High Definition Television (UHDTV) systems, defining the technical aspects and specifications for 4K resolution. The International Telecommunication Union (ITU) sets the UHDTV standard, ensuring uniformity across devices and platforms.

Evolution and Adoption

The rise in 4K television market share is attributed to declining prices, making this advanced technology more accessible to consumers. Platforms like YouTube and the television industry have standardized 3840 × 2160 as the 4K resolution, enhancing content quality and viewer experience. Furthermore, the introduction of mobile phones capable of recording at 2160p has expanded the reach of 4K technology to everyday users.

Technical Specs

The Digital Cinema System Specification by DCI outlines technical specifications essential for delivering high-resolution content in theaters, ensuring exceptional clarity and detail. SMPTE ST 2036-1 defines parameters such as frame rates and color spaces for UHDTV systems, guaranteeing consistent performance across devices. ITU's Recommendation ITU-R BT.2020 establishes standards for color gamut, dynamic range, and resolution in 4K displays, enhancing visual quality and realism.

Exploring 4K Resolutions

Common Resolutions

"4K" and "Ultra HD" are often used interchangeably in marketing, but 4K technically refers to a resolution of 3840×2160 pixels, equivalent to 8.3 megapixels. In contrast, "2K" is standard 1080p, while 4K offers four times the pixels for clearer images.

Technical Aspects of 4K

Chroma Subsampling

Chroma subsampling reduces color information to optimize storage and bandwidth in 4K content. It compresses chrominance data, affecting color accuracy. In 4K displays, subsampling can lead to slight color inaccuracies due to reduced chroma resolution.

Chroma subsampling plays a crucial role in managing color data efficiently in 4K videos. By discarding redundant color information, it enables smoother streaming and storage. However, this compression technique may result in subtle color artifacts in 4K images.

Bit Rates

Bit rates indicate the amount of data transmitted per second in 4K video streaming. Higher bit rates enhance video quality by preserving more details. In 4K content, bit rates directly impact clarity, sharpness, and overall viewing experience.

In 4K streaming, maintaining high bit rates poses challenges like network congestion and buffering issues. Balancing optimal bit rates is essential to ensure smooth playback and minimize interruptions. Insufficient bit rates can lead to pixelation and loss of image fidelity in 4K videos.

M+ RGBW Controversy

The controversy around M+ RGBW technology revolves around its impact on color accuracy in 4K displays. While M+ RGBW enhances brightness and energy efficiency, it sacrifices some color precision. Consumers debate whether the trade-off is acceptable for improved performance.

Using M+ RGBW panels can boost brightness levels and reduce power consumption in 4K screens. However, critics argue that this technology compromises color reproduction accuracy. The controversy over M+ RGBW highlights the importance of balancing brightness enhancements with color fidelity for consumer satisfaction.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is 4K technology?

4K technology refers to display devices with a horizontal resolution of approximately 4,000 pixels. It provides incredibly sharp and detailed images, offering a superior viewing experience compared to lower resolutions.

How does 4K technology enhance viewing experience?

4K technology delivers exceptional clarity, vibrant colors, and increased detail in images and videos. It offers a more immersive viewing experience with sharper visuals, making it ideal for enjoying high-quality content like movies and games.

Is 4K content widely available?

Yes, the availability of 4K content has been increasing steadily. Many streaming services, TV channels, and online platforms offer a variety of content in 4K resolution, including movies, TV shows, sports events, and documentaries.
